> Please don't change keyboard mappings randomly. There are standards
> for many keymaps and these should be respected as much as possible
> *and keep the established practices*.
> 
> This is why I think the "dead_tilde" change should be reverted
> even if it conforms to a standard (I didn't check but that's very
> possible because of that being the behaviour in MS Windows). This is
> *established practice*.

AFAIK that's the behaviour in Windows, but as you say...

> Also, please all think that Spanish keymaps are not only used for
> Castellano, but also for Catalan, Galician, Basque [...] Catalan
> uses grave accents, for instance.
> 
> And, well, being able to type correct French with a Spanish keyboard
> is not that stupid, right? :-)

And many Galician users write Portuguese as well, and for us the dead
tilde is completely essential :-)

Those annoyed by AltGr+4 producing a dead tilde can use AltGr+ñ and
AltGr+¡ anyway :)
